Subject: DR drill notes — Tallgrove matching service GC pauses

Hi — ahead of review, context on last week's drill. We simulated region loss while the matcher ran under peak load, and the old collector produced 900ms pauses that tripped failover health checks prematurely. The patch moves session state off-heap and tunes pause targets; please scrutinize the arena sizing. During the drill, restoring the standby admin account requires the DR vault, which opens only with the recovery passphrase recorded just below.

unlock words, yawig-kagef: gordor-holvan-ulaael-pramir-ulaiel-tamdor

**Step 7 — Read-Replica Lag Alarm.** Before sealing the new signing keys for Mirevale's replication cluster, confirm the lag alarm on replica set B is armed and reporting under five seconds. If the alarm fires during the ceremony, pause and verify with the scribe before continuing; key material must not rotate during a lag event. To re-arm the alarm console afterward, enter the recovery passphrase shown below.

unlock words, kagef-taduf: fenir-quenix-norwyn-sorvan-gormir-gorir-fraok

Hi support folks,

Quick heads-up: next Thursday we're running the quarterly disaster-recovery drill for Huewatch, our color-contrast accessibility audit tool. During the drill the main dashboard goes dark, so ticket volume may spike — just tag anything contrast-related with the drill flag. If you need to restore the backup audit console yourself, it's in the warm-standby vault. Access requires the recovery passphrase, which you'll find right below this line.

unlock words, hahip-yagef: zorok-novmir-zorix-silax

Release checklist — Lanternkey password reset revamp

[ ] Confirm reset tokens expire after fifteen minutes and are single-use; new team members, note that the old flow allowed reuse within the window, which we deliberately removed. Verify the confirmation screen never reveals whether an account exists, test the rate limiter on repeated requests, and run the email template suite in staging. When every box is checked, confirm you tested against the build recorded below.

pipeline stamp: htk31_f769b577b3028a4e9958e5bb8d1259a